Oakland Choral Society Presents J.S. Bach: Magnificat and Christmas Oratorio

The Oakland Choral Society, under the direction of Frederic DeHaven, will present J.S. Bach: Magnificat and Christmas Oratorio, Parts I and II on Sunday, Dec. 4, at 3 p.m. 

The concert with orchestra and soloists will be presented at St. Jane Frances de Chantal Catholic Church, 38750 Ryan Road, Sterling Heights, MI 48310. Soloists for the program are Jeanne Bourget, soprano; Kristin Eder, alto; Brian White, tenor; and Edward Pember, bass.

Tickets, $15 and $25, are available in advance by calling 248-391-0184, or at the door.

Oakland Choral Society has been an educational and performance chorus since 1963 and has promoted enjoyment and appreciation of choral music as an artistic expression. It is dedicated to achieving excellence in musical performance and enriching the lives of both participants and audience.
